Gretchen the German Shepherd Dog
Published on Jan 1st, 2008
By Marie Bowman (Mississippi)
Gretchen died from cancer. I miss her so much I feel like I can't stand it. I got her when she was seven weeks old, a fat ball of fur. She was with me through every bad time in my life over the past 91/2 years; standing quietly by, licking my hand or licking away my tears. She would have died for me. I think she knew I would have done anything I could to make her well, but I just didn't have the power. I am thankful to God that she passed away peacefully, naturally, without my having to make that awful decision: something I told God I didn't think I could do.
I love you Gretch, you will always be with me. When I see you in my mind, I see you with your ball in your mouth, tail wagging and giving me that sideways mischeivous look as if you're saying, "come get it, if you can!" Oh, how I wish you were here to lick away my tears one more time.
Until we meet again, I love you, I miss you, and I hope you know, God couldn't have given me a greater gift than you. Farewell, old friend.
